Design of VDC photovoltaic and wind power hybrid system using smart relay/
This project is developed to produce 24 V DC by photovoltaic and wind power hybrid system using smart relay. The smart relay SR3 B261JD from Schneider Electric is used to operate as controller that will choose the highest voltage produced between photovoltaic and wind
